💱 Exchange rates
The nervous system of the global financial system: Exchange rates determine how much one currency is worth relative to another. They influence trade, inflation, corporate profits, capital flows, and investment decisions. For investors, exchange rates are a key factor that can increase or decrease returns. 🛡️Währungsgehedgte ETFs
Stable returns despite fluctuating exchange rates: Currency-hedged ETFs protect investors from exchange rate fluctuations between their home currency and the currency of the target market. They are particularly suitable during volatile currency periods or when investors want to track the pure market performance of a country or sector without currency influence.
